Mention any six effects of the Earth’s rotation.

Six effects of the Earth’s rotation are:

  • The rotation of the Earth causes day and night. The part of the Earth facing the Sun experiences day while the part which does not face the Sun experiences night.
  • The speed of the Earth’s rotation influences the shape of the Earth. Because of the speed of its rotation, a centrifugal force is created which leads to the flattening of the Earth at the poles and bulging at its centre.
  • The Earth’s rotation affects the movement of water in the oceans and is responsible for the sea tides.
  • The speed of rotation also affects the movement of the wind. Due to the Earth’s rotation, winds and the ocean currents deflect to the right in the Northern Hemisphere and to the left in the Southern Hemisphere.
  • It causes a difference between the times at various places on the Earth. The difference between the times of each longitude is 4 minutes.
